What Are Access & Utility Hatches?
Access and utility hatches are one of the most functional yet often overlooked pieces of hardware on any boat. Access and utility hatches are framed panels installed in deck surfaces, bulkheads, cockpit soles, and hull sides to provide convenient entry points to the spaces below — storage compartments, bilge areas, livewells, wiring runs, fuel lines, and mechanical systems that would otherwise be difficult or impossible to reach.
A quality hatch does far more than simply open and close. It must seal reliably against water intrusion, hold up under foot traffic, resist the constant assault of UV radiation, saltwater spray, and vibration, and remain operable season after season. Getting the right hatch for your application is critical not just for convenience, but for the long-term health and safety of your vessel.
Types of Access & Utility Hatches
Hatches come in a range of styles suited to different needs and mounting locations:
- Flush / Low-Profile Hatches: These sit level with the deck surface, minimizing trip hazards and maintaining a clean, streamlined appearance. They are especially popular on fishing boats and performance vessels where deck space is at a premium.
- Standard Profile Hatches: Offer a slightly raised frame that can be easier to grip and operate, making them a practical choice for utility access where aesthetics are secondary.
- Locking Hatches: Feature integrated lock cylinders to secure valuables, tackle, or safety gear against unauthorized access.
- Removable Door Hatches: Allow full, unobstructed access to larger compartments by detaching the lid entirely rather than swinging it open on a hinge.
Key Considerations When Shopping for Hatches
Choosing the right hatch starts with careful measurement. It's essential to confirm the cutout dimensions, frame size, lid thickness, hinge type, and the load requirements before purchasing. Even a small mismatch can compromise the water seal or prevent a proper fit.
Material selection is equally important. Marine-grade polymers, UV-stabilized resins, and corrosion-resistant stainless steel hardware are the standards to look for in any quality hatch. Latch style matters too — cam latches provide adjustable compression on gaskets for a reliable seal, while slam latches allow for quick positive closure in rough conditions. For high-traffic deck areas, look for structurally engineered "walk-on" lids rated to support the weight of crew members standing on them.
For boats that see rough water or are regularly exposed to spray and rain, a dual-seal design — where both the lid and the frame incorporate sealing gaskets — provides an extra layer of water protection over single-seal alternatives.
